Output 7376c060cd9809bc692aaf4aefcdef80eef15cbbc8bb41cbd0b6e7bb35a8a321:2

value
31627584
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f123e592b13a83d6f85ab7cf0e80d5526b96782 OP_EQUAL
address
3EjWQZQEgVqCmkRCStsz9xJLPvYY5eo95a
transaction
7376c060cd9809bc692aaf4aefcdef80eef15cbbc8bb41cbd0b6e7bb35a8a321
spent
true